1. Tambopata Research Center Stay: The Deep Immersion

Tambopata Research Center

When people actually talk about a deep Amazon experience, the Tambopata Research Center is often mentioned. So, imagine this: a multi-day adventure into the heart of the Tambopata National Reserve. So, it’s more than just a stay; it’s an opportunity to participate in real research. It seems like the lodge actually works with scientists, so you could, you know, learn directly from them as they study the jungle’s secrets. Anyway, that’s super unique, right?

This pass-type deal typically gets you accommodation at the Research Center, all your meals, guided jungle hikes (day and night!), plus boat rides along the Tambopata River. And, as a matter of fact, a definite highlight could be seeing the macaw clay lick – pretty much one of the Amazon’s most stunning natural displays. As I was saying, hundreds of colorful macaws and parrots get together to eat clay, which helps neutralize toxins in their diet. It can be pretty spectacular!

Why this is very cool: The focus, in a way, is environmental, and educational tourism gives you that connection to both the science behind the preservation efforts in Tambopata and, like, a very deeper understanding of the jungle’s intricate workings. Anyway, seeing scientists in action while having an impact through your trip can be very cool.

2. Sandoval Lake Lodge Experience: Tranquility Found

Sandoval Lake Lodge

If quiet Amazonian waters is more of what you need, anyway, staying at a lodge on Sandoval Lake might be a cool alternative to explore the amazing wildlife. Basically, the Sandoval Lake Lodge deal usually gives you things like your stay, meals, as well as organized tours. It can actually be really easy to get to from Puerto Maldonado because the lake sits just outside of town. It looks like the lack of motorized boats on the lake is really helpful in letting you have that truly undisturbed jungle adventure, though, right?

A cool perk would probably be the chance to see the Giant River Otters, pretty much iconic to the Amazon. Honestly, these playful creatures are a lot of fun to watch as they hunt and socialize. So, too it’s almost a guaranteed spotting, given their protected habitat, makes it a worthwhile part of your trip. Anyway, caiman spotting tours at night can also be interesting and show another kind of nighttime view.
